If there's a perception that defence is getting away with return to asking a woman what she was wearing when she was raped or ignoring the complex realities of abusive relationships involving sexual violence, then people just won't report what has happened to them. It's as simple as that.

When we talk about this judgment, let's not forget that changes to questioning and evidence didn't come about because we became afraid to make women a wee bit uncomfortable in court - it's because women who had raped were regularly being subjected to irrelevant, invasive and aggressive questioning.

In judgment itself, there was worryingly little exploration of why rules about evidence became necessary in first place. It accepts that certain questioning is 'embarrassing' for complainers, but stops short of considering how it can affect the outcome of cases. In short, Article 6 trumps Article 8.

Yes, this judgment will lead to more successful applications around sexual history and character evidence. However, it was also very clear: not all evidence around sexual history or character *should* be considered relevant to the case. And Lord Advocate has indicated today that they won't be.

It is difficult to tell rape survivors that, through no fault of their own, their journey with criminal justice process might not be over. Or prepare someone for court knowing the goal posts are shifting. To tell someone who has already given evidence that there is a chance they will be recalled.

Current process isn't likely to change beyond recognition. What is concerning is that we can't give survivors advice about whether or not the person who raped them might be able to open back up a case that they thought was finished. The limbo and uncertainty is the headline issue for us right now.

Are appeals only going to look at cases where applications around sexual history and character evidence have been rejected? Or, more likely, are lawyers going to effectively argue that they never made the applications in the first place because they knew they were doomed to fail?
